Podcast Overview

What Now? Jom Ah Lepak!! Podcast is a vibrant platform co-founded by friends Haikal and Haziq, celebrating the Malaysian essence and empowering listeners through inspirational narratives. In the lively mix of Manglish, a fusion of Malay and English widely spoken in Malaysia, the podcast dives into personal reflections, explores current affairs, answers youth's burning questions, and features captivating interviews with influential Malaysian figures. S6 EP2: Addiction Isn’t a Crime — So Why Is Our Law Treating It Like One? Ft. Dr Prem

Dr. Prem, founder of Solace Asia, discusses addiction recovery, challenges the stigma of relapse, and unpacks the limitations of Malaysia’s drug laws in this interview episode.

S6 #1 Classroom X: Teaching with Superpowers (WNJAL Teacher's Day Special)

<p></p><p>What if your teacher turned your classroom into the X-Men’s Danger Room — complete with missions, characters, and roleplay?</p><p>In this special two-part Teachers' Day episode of <strong>What Now? Jom Ah Lepak!!</strong>, we sit down with <strong>Cikgu Nazmi</strong>, the winner of the <strong>2023 Global Teacher Prize Malaysia</strong>, known for his out-of-the-box approach to education in rural Sarawak. Inspired by comic books, anime, and his students’ real-life struggles, he designed a gamified classroom concept called The Danger Room — transforming lessons into powerful stories and experiences that help students build confidence, critical thinking, and creativity.</p><p>We talk about:</p><ul><li><p>How being posted to a rural school shaped his views on education</p></li><li><p>His love for comic books and the role they play in his teaching</p></li><li><p>The story and process behind creating The Danger Room</p></li><li><p>Why storytelling belongs in the classroom</p></li><li><p>What he learned from global educators and mentors like Anuthra</p></li><li><p>His dreams for the future of learning in Malaysia</p></li></ul><p>This is a celebration of teachers who dare to dream differently — and help students do the same.</p><p></p>

Edu Series EP8: Reimagining Higher Education with TS Idris Jusoh: Leadership, Innovation, and Impact

<p><br /></p> <p>In this episode, we sit down with Tan Sri Idris Jusoh, a visionary leader whose contributions have significantly shaped Malaysia's education landscape. From his formative years in Terengganu to his impactful roles as Menteri Besar and Minister of Higher Education, TS Idris shares his journey, insights, and forward-thinking initiatives that have left a lasting legacy.</p> <p><strong>1. Worldview and Leadership:</strong></p> <ul> <li>TS Idris reflects on his upbringing in a developing Terengganu and how diverse educational experiences fueled his passion for continuous learning and leadership.</li> <li>He shares the vision behind the <strong>Ulul Albab Program</strong>, balancing Islamic and general studies to nurture holistic thinkers.</li> <li>Insight into his tenure managing the Ministry of Education and Ministry of Higher Education, emphasizing the pressure and responsibility of shaping the nation’s future.</li> </ul> <p><strong>2. Transformative Initiatives and Lasting Impact:</strong></p> <ul> <li>The groundbreaking introduction of <strong>APEL (Accreditation of Prior Experiential Learning)</strong> to provide educational opportunities for all.</li> <li>Key initiatives to enhance campus life, fostering a competitive and nurturing environment for students.</li> <li>Ensuring university curriculums align with industry demands, particularly with the rise of <strong>IR 4.0 technologies</strong>.</li> </ul> <p><strong>3. Reflection and Future Directions in Education:</strong></p> <ul> <li>Early advocacy for <strong>Open and Distance Learning (ODL)</strong> and its untapped potential before the pandemic spotlighted its necessity.</li> <li>The rationale behind significant investments in the education sector and their role in building competent human capital.</li> <li>Addressing challenges like bridging the gap between students' degrees </li> </ul> <p><br /></p> <p>This episode is a treasure trove of wisdom for youth, policymakers, and educators alike, offering practical insights to navigate and innovate the future of education.</p> <p><br /></p> <p> </p> <p>#HigherEducation #LeadershipMatters #FutureReady #EducationInnovation #StudentSuccess #EdTech #TransformingEducation #UniversityLife #LearningForLife #EducationPolicy #NextGenLeaders #FutureOfLearning #InspiringChange #IR4.0 #GlobalEducation</p> <p> </p> <p><br /></p>
